Easy Homemade Yogurt Bread Starter That Anyone Can Make

  1. Put all the ingredients in a jar that has been sterlized in boiling water, close the lid, and just leave it alone.
  2. Don't mix with a spoon as this will introduce unwanted microorganisms.
  3. Just shake lightly.
  4. On the second day it'll start to bubble.
  5. If you leave it in a warm place it will ferment faster.
  6. After a day or two once it has become very bubbly it's complete.
  7. Open the lid once a day and shake the jar around.
  8. If it foams up vigorously it's complete!
  9. When you open the lid you should hear the sound of air escaping with a whoosing sound
  10. Once your starter is complete, store it in the refrigerator.
